CONCEPT: to develop a series of short movies (linear sniplets, slide shows, integrated hyperimages...) from footage/material of systemic camera recordings, that would capture big collection of images (video frames) and index them for types of information (time stamp, content, image analasys, user made metadata...)

INSPIRATION: development of the concept for this kind of project for observing public space has been inspired by different discussions and issues raised among activists and artists who are interested in working on and about mediating public space:
• primarily from discussions on video surveillance systems in public spaces - especially UK regulation, where possibility exists for one to access these materials if were recorded on them and practice their right to be removed/blurred out of recording.
• on issues of visual pollution of urban spaces which are clattered with more and more aggressive advertising - with huge differences diminishing in terms of western and eastern Europe practices where (due to socialist past with state economies and non advertising) this
is still a process - that could possibly still be influenced.
• discussions on how public spaces of historic and cultural importance are most often overtaken by tourists, which grouped in high numbers and organised in specific time slots fail to enjoy the environment - therefore direct mediating (streaming video signal) from these places makes them impossible.

With these questions, facts and challenges it seemed important to try to address them in both symbolic way (as most art projects do), but also in practical way (as activists would prefer).

RESEARCH: after initial period of research and consulting with software developer and media artist Daniel Fischer it became possible to plan development of such setup. With use of motion detection software that would analyze camera input (from analogue video source) and compare frames to detect changes in-between images one could exclude motion and manipulate it in different aspects (change of pixel values: color, luminance and transparency). Goal of achieving quality of video image that would be in the same time clear statement and also a medium of transposing unique "genius loci" in mediated form of web
stream would take a lot of experiments with applying different image processing techniques. This output could than be streamed to the publicly accessible net address and provide them with real-time video stream from location (while all objects in motion are processed in
real time). Archive of this cam input could be later used for generating "compiling movies" that would construct video footage based on database-like queries.

For development of project programmer skilled in Free Software for media production and with knowledge of image processing would be required. There is a possibility also to partially share development with Daniel Fischer who could take part in residency for shorter period of time.
